Output 707364dcce572d330050cea5a5320cca031eda1735b40ca75433a022a69d9d91:91

value
4452096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cba9e1eeefa5129de2b5f74db0a572b08abc0faa OP_EQUAL
address
3LFtc8cF2jTLXm857VN6kAF8yDBYHnUSQx
transaction
707364dcce572d330050cea5a5320cca031eda1735b40ca75433a022a69d9d91
spent
true